
alvinalexander.com » Scala
1,000 FOLLOWERS
This website, alvinalexander.com, was created by Alvin J. Alexander. It's a website where Alvin J. Alexander shares various thoughts and write tutorials on technical topics. Follow this blog for tutorials about the Scala programming language.
alvinalexander.com » Scala
13h ago
This weekend I just released the shiny new paperback version of Learn Functional Programming The Fast Way! . And for the first 48 hours — until roughly the end of March 28, 2023 — you can buy it for half-price ..read more
alvinalexander.com » Scala
13h ago
If you’re interested in this sort of thing, this is the full paperback cover of my new book, Learn Functional Programming The Fast Way! , as seen in Amazon’s previewer ..read more
alvinalexander.com » Scala
13h ago
You can now download a large, preview of my new book, Learn Functional Programming The Fast Way! . Just follow that link and go to the Free Preview section. The book is 250 pages in length, and the free preview is 128 pages long, so it really is a large preview, and it’s FREE ..read more
alvinalexander.com » Scala
1w ago
You can currently find the PDF version of Learn Functional Programming The Fast Way! because (a) I think it’s more reflective of today’s world, and (b) it’s consistent with my other book, Learn Scala 3 The Fast Way ..read more
alvinalexander.com » Scala
1M ago
While fooling around recently with various computer programming algorithms, I ended up writing an implementation of the Adler-32 checksum algorithm in source code for my Adler-32 checksum implementation ..read more
alvinalexander.com » Scala
1M ago
What’s the easiest way to learn ” If you look at all of the books on the right side of this image, I can tell you that reading all of those books an easy way to learn functional programming (FP): The lessons in the free PDF you can find at that URL include ..read more
alvinalexander.com » Scala
1M ago
I don’t have any major conclusions to share in this blog post, but ... what I was curious about is how Scala implements “lazy val” fields. That is, when the Scala code I write is translated into a file and bytecode that a JVM can understand, what does ..read more
alvinalexander.com » Scala
1M ago
control structure that is helpful in several ways. First, it can be used to automatically close any resource that has a method. Second, it's a great example of how to create a custom Here's the source code for the ..read more
alvinalexander.com » Scala
1M ago
If you’re looking for a unique gift for yourself or the computer programmer in your life, I just created these coffee mug designs . There are two different designs, one with four book covers and another with three book covers, and both of them completely wrap around the mug. helps to keep me writing and teaching about Scala, so I’m trying to find new and unique ways to thank my supporters. If you like coffee, tea, or any other beverage in a mug, I hope you’ll like these new designs ..read more
alvinalexander.com » Scala
2M ago
I don’t know if I’ll keep this going or not, but I was looking for a way to monitor “What’s new in Scala,” so I thought I’d create a “This week in Scala” page. Here’s what’s new the week of January 15-21, 2023 ..read more